Functional and physical competition between phospholamban and its mutants provides insight into the molecular mechanism of gene therapy for heart failure.
Biochemical and biophysical research communications - 13 May 2011
Lockamy Elizabeth L, Cornea Razvan L, Karim Christine B, Thomas David D
Abstract excerpt
We have used functional co-reconstitution of purified sarcoplasmic reticulum (SR) Ca(2+)-ATPase (SERCA) with phospholamban (PLB), its inhibitor in the heart, to test the hypothesis that loss-of-function (LOF) PLB mutants (PLB(M)) can compete with wild-type PLB (PLB(W)) to relieve SERCA inhibition. Co-reconstitution at varying PLB-to-SERCA ratios was conducted using synthetic PLB(W), gain-of-function mutant I40A,...
